EH54 8LQ is a compact residential postcode in Scotland, spanning 4.6 hectares. It is a small, tightly knit area where daily life revolves around nearby amenities and straightforward connectivity. The postcode is served by multiple railway stations, including Uphall, Livingston North, and Livingston South, making commuting to larger towns seamless. Retail options are accessible, with notable stores such as M&S Deer Park BP, Aldi Livingston, and Co-op Uphall within practical reach. The area’s broadband score of 97 indicates excellent fixed-line internet quality, while mobile coverage scores at 83 suggest good connectivity for most needs. Though small, EH54 8LQ offers a balance of convenience and quiet living, appealing to those prioritising accessibility without the bustle of larger urban centres. Its proximity to rail links and retail hubs makes it a practical choice for families and professionals seeking reliable infrastructure without sacrificing space.

What is the broadband quality in EH54 8LQ?
Broadband in EH54 8LQ scores 97/100, indicating excellent fixed-line internet quality. Mobile coverage is good at 83/100, suitable for most daily needs.
How accessible is public transport in EH54 8LQ?
The area has five nearby railway stations, including Uphall and Livingston North, offering direct links to major towns and cities.
Are there any environmental risks in EH54 8LQ?
No significant risks are present, with low flood risk and no protected natural sites within the postcode.
What retail options are available near EH54 8LQ?
Residents can access M&S Deer Park BP, Aldi Livingston, and Co-op Uphall, providing essential shopping within reach.
